Step-by-Step: How to Crochet a Simple Braid
What You’ll Need:
- Crochet hook (size suited to yarn)
- Soft, lightweight yarn (acrylic or cotton recommended)
- Scissors and a tape measure
- Optional: beads, shells, or decorative tassels
Basic Technique:
- Prepare Your Yarn: Choose a thin to medium-weight yarn for detail work. Cut a 4–5 meter length to start.
- Create the Foundation Stitch: Use a basic chain stitch to build the base.
- Interlock the Strand: Alternately hook adjacent strands and pull through to form interlocking loops—this creates the braid’s braided texture.
- Shape and Adjust: Continue crocheting, shaping the braid in length or width as desired. Secure the end with a slip knot.

Pro Tip:
Practice with bulkier yarn first for faster results, then experiment with finer threads for more delicate braids.
Styling Your Crochet Braid
- Everyday Wear: Opt for subtle, neutral tones and compact designs for professional or casual outfits.
- Festivals & Boho Fashion: Use bright colors, floral motifs, and layered textures to embrace a free-spirited look.
- Special Occasions: Add embellishments like metallic threads, pearls, or sequins for a glamorous touch.
- Bohemian Beach Style: Lightweight braids with tassels and dreamy fabrics pair beautifully with boho dresses or sundresses.

Tips for Successful Crochet Braiding
- Practice Tension Control: Even tension ensures uniform texture and longevity.
- Use High-Quality Yarn: Soft, strong fibers prevent breakage and maintain shape.
- Keep Tools Handy: Small scissors, beads, and a tape measure help refine details.
